Waxing strips are an essential component of the hair removal process, used to adhere wax and subsequently remove unwanted hair from the skin. These strips are typically made of cloth or paper and are designed for use with hot or cold wax. They offer a convenient and efficient method for achieving smooth skin, particularly for large areas such as the legs, arms, and back.
